Stop lenders/servicers from taking your tax dollar money and refusing to modify/refinance your mortgage loan. In order to help America and its people come out of this economic crisis, we need government, banks and homeowners to work together to fix our housing market. Please sign this petition and let your voice be heard. Say NO to "loan modification denied"

As a homeowner, I am tired of being dragged around by banks only to find out that I do not qualify for a loan modification based on an unreasonable excuse. We need to let the government know that the loan modification program is not working or helping homeowners. Rather, it is enriching the pockets of banks with our money. That's shameful!

Please sign this petition and voice your frustration, say NO to "loan modification denied"
